Film slag disposal system
Technical field
The utility model is provided with waste disposal field, particularly a kind for the treatment of system of the film slag for the treatment of producing in wiring board production process and treatment process.
Background technology
In wiring board manufacturing enterprise, dry film and wet film processing procedure is all be unable to do without in wiring board production processes all at present, dry film and the photosensitive film, wet film and anti-welding green oil, in the process of producing, this tunic is needed to peel off, NAOH liquid medicine is used to peel off, the a collection of discarded film slag of such output, and this film slag is alkaline mud shape, decomposition is not had to come, can not regeneration, can not arbitrarily abandon, producer is had to be mostly the film slag produced to collect to deposit at present, or be mixed in wastewater treatment, force together with mud, so also can cause blue pollution, mud is strong basicity simultaneously, also can pollute by force soil reclamation, therefore these materials can not arbitrarily abandon, can only forever also exist, these materials all cannot be degraded decades the same as white plastic, severe contamination can be caused to environment if arbitrarily abandoned.For wiring board manufacturer, store the operation cost that a large amount of film slags can improve enterprise, when supervising not tight, enterprise can arbitrarily abandon film slag, very serious pollution will be caused like this to environment, therefore how effectively process film slag, film slag is recycled become the technical problem that wiring board manufacturer is badly in need of solving.

As shown in Figure 1, 2, the utility model provides a kind of film slag disposal system, and it comprises lifting turning device 1, film slag neutralizing treatment groove 5, pressure filter 6 three major portions.Lifting turning device 1 is mainly used in being promoted to by barrel 2 above film slag neutralizing treatment groove 5, and is overturn by barrel, is poured into by the film slag in barrel 2 in film slag neutralizing treatment groove 5.The structure of lifting turning device 1 is prior art, therefore is not described in detail at this.
Film slag neutralizing treatment groove 5, for holding film slag, is provided with pulverizer 3 in the ingress of film slag neutralizing treatment groove 5, and pulverizer 3, for being pulverized by the film slag entering film slag neutralizing treatment groove 5, makes the film slag of bulk become little bulk.In film slag neutralizing treatment groove 5, be also provided with stirrer 4, stirrer 4 is for stirring into sheet by the film slag in film slag neutralizing treatment groove.
In film slag neutralizing treatment groove 5, be also provided with a chemical liquid adding apparatus, this chemical liquid adding apparatus is used for adding sulfuric acid in film slag neutralizing treatment groove, neutralizes film slag.As a kind of embodiment, chemical liquid adding apparatus comprises sulfuric acid and adds pump 14, sulfuric acid transfer lime and tank for sulphuric acid 13, one end of sulfuric acid transfer lime is positioned at tank for sulphuric acid 13, the other end is positioned at film slag neutralizing treatment groove 5, sulfuric acid adds pump 14 and is positioned on sulfuric acid transfer lime, add pump 14 by sulfuric acid the sulfuric acid in tank for sulphuric acid 13 to be delivered in film slag neutralizing treatment groove 5, neutralizing treatment is carried out to it.In film slag neutralizing treatment groove 5, be also provided with a pH value sensor, this pH value sensor is for detecting the film slag pH value in film slag neutralizing treatment groove.PH value sensor is connected with Controlling System, and the controlled Sulphuric acid of Controlling System adds pump 14 and works.For the ease of stirring, also can water inlet pipe being set in film slag neutralizing treatment groove 5, being added water in film slag neutralizing treatment groove 5 by water inlet pipe, film slag is diluted.
Also be provided with a separating device for water with dregs in the side of film slag neutralizing treatment groove 5, this separating device for water with dregs is used for the film slag after by neutralization and is separated with water.As a kind of optimal way, separating device for water with dregs can select pressure filter.Pressure filter 6 is positioned at the side of film slag neutralizing treatment groove 5, and the film slag of becoming reconciled in film slag neutralizing treatment groove 5 is delivered on pressure filter 6 by film slag e Foerderanlage.As a kind of embodiment, film slag e Foerderanlage comprises film slag transfer lime 8, film slag transferpump 7, film slag transferpump 7 is exactly in fact a slush pump, one end of film slag transfer lime 8 is positioned at film slag neutralizing treatment groove 5, the other end is positioned at above pressure filter, film slag transferpump 7 is positioned on film slag transfer lime 8, just film slag can be delivered to pressure filter 6 carry out press filtration by film slag transferpump 7.
Solid film slag through pressure filter 6 press filtration can be stayed in pressure filter 6, the crushed water leached can flow in the recovery tank 11 below pressure filter 6 by back of pipeline, reclaim in tank 11 and be provided with refining plant, can purify water, water after purification can be passed through return water pipe 12 and is again back in film slag neutralizing treatment groove 5 and carries out recycle, like this can effective saving water resource.After pressure in pressure filter 6 is full, film slag transferpump 7 will quit work, also be provided with an air-dry apparatus 9 on a filter press simultaneously, residual water in pressure filter can be blown clean by air-dry apparatus 9, now get final product discharging, also be provided with in the below of pressure filter 6 and connect slag bag 10, the neutral film that can become sheet through the film slag of pressure filter 6 press filtration is collected in and connects in slag bag 10.
Because sulfuric acid addition is fewer, tank for sulphuric acid 13 need adopt the PE bucket groove of about 300L, reclaims the PE bucket groove that tank needs to adopt about 3T.The film slag often processing about 500L needs about 30L to have sulfuric acid, and therefore about 300L has supporting about the 50T of tank for sulphuric acid groove to have film slag, very economical, and the recirculation water of this cover system recycles simultaneously, can not cause too many waste.
Separating device for water with dregs, except employing pressure filter, also can adopt whizzer to adopt whizzer to dry the film slag after neutralization, and the mode of drying again also or after adopting mesh-belt conveying to filter, be separated with water by film slag, process is clean.
When adopting this film slag disposal system process film slag, first will be poured in film slag neutralizing treatment groove, and be broken down into fritter, and then add water in film slag neutralizing treatment groove and stir, the film slag of fritter is resolved into again blocks of film, while stirring, add sulfuric acid until the PH test value of groove inner membrance slag is about 7 to film slag neutralizing treatment groove, finally the film slag be stirred is delivered in pressure filter and carry out press filtration.
